Can Xavi Save Barcelona as his Team Faces the Mighty Bayern?

A test of fire awaits Xavi Hernandez as Barcelona has to clash against Bayern Munich to save their Champions League campaign. Xavi took over as Interim manager for Barcelona on 6th Nov and is expected to be in the role till the end of the season.

If he manages to impress he may continue as the permanent manager. However, as of now, it’s all going downhill for Barcelona this season. Ever since Leo Messi’s departure, the club has been in rebuild mode. Ronald Koeman did a decent job of pushing up younger talent.

As a result, Barcelona does have some talented individuals for the future but as of now, their squad looks average. It’s a must-win game for Barcelona against an opponent which has thrashed them before in the same competition.

What will Xavi’s strategy be against a club of Bayern’s stature?

For the second consecutive time, Bayern Munich stands in Barcelona’s way. However, this time around there will be no Lionel Messi to save Barcelona. Considering the team which the Catalonians have the best hope for Barcelona is to go with a defensive lineup.

The priority must be to try and defend their goal and then hit Bayern on the counterattack. There are some young talented players on the team and they do carry a threat on the counter.

Barcelona is expected to line up in a 3-4-2-1 formation. This should add some stability to their defense and midfield along with keeping a sharp edge in their attack. This is a formation that is less used in modern times with the development of the 3-5-2 system.

However, the 3-4-2-1 system could be best suited for Nico Gonzalez and Gavi as they can slot in the 2 along with Memphis as a striker. However, Memphis hasn’t been in the best of forms and yesterday is gonna be a tough game for him.

Barcelona could still survive if Benfica isn’t able to win

The situation is set up in this way that Barcelona needs to secure a victory if they want their fate to be in their hands. As things stand Barcelona has 7 points and Benfica has 5. If Benfica fails to win then Barcelona will qualify automatically.

However, if Benfica does manage to win then Barcelona will have to secure a victory too. A draw will not be sufficient because then Benfica would go through on-goal difference. Benfica faces Dynamo Kyiv and there is a high chance that they will emerge victoriously.

Barcelona needs to treat this as a must-win game. If they fail to qualify it will be only the 3rd time since 2000 when the Catalonians will have failed to reach the Round of 16 of the Champions League.

Veterans Gerard Pique, Sergio Busquets will have to shoulder the responsibility because Bayern will be out of the blood. However, the Bavarians might be a little overconfident about their chances to emerge victoriously.

This is the one thing that can work out in Barcelona’s favor and as the famous saying goes, “In football, anything can happen”. It will be a tough ask but bigger upsets have happened and would surely be premature to count the Catalonians out just yet.
